Abstract
Although the coding mode of non-RDO in H.264 greatly increases the execution speed of intra prediction, shorter execution time is required. A new intra prediction mode decision algorithm is proposed. First, the intra prediction mode of two chroma macroblocks of same location is only decided by one chroma block. Second, the idea of low resolution and SAD criterion are exploited to select the best 16 times 16 intra prediction mode of luma macroblock quickly, and the number of candidates for the intra prediction modes of 4 times 4 subblock of luma macroblock is reduced by the best 16 times 16 intra prediction mode and block location. Then the coding type and the prediction mode of the luma macroblock are decided by flexible cost comparison. Simulation results show that the proposed algorithm greatly reduce computational load of the intra prediction mode decision with negligible loss of PSNR and little increase of bite-rate.
